    Abstract

    The entangled property of Yurke-like state was investigated via spin squeezing. Since the Yurke-like state is superposed by a symmetric state and two special multi-particle states, the entangled property can be studied by investigating superposition coefficient and relative phase’s influence on spin squeezing parameter. The analytical results for the optimal squeezed direction and optimal squeezing were obtained via extremum method. It’s shown that the spin squeezing parameter monotonously changes with superposition coefficients and periodically changes with relative phase. It is also shown that the more the number of the particles is, the stronger the degree of squeezing will be.
